Tim Sherwood tips Manchester City for Premier League title

Tottenham boss Tim Sherwood backs Manchester City to win the title this season despite his side being thrashed 4-0 by Liverpool this afternoon.

Tottenham Hotspur manager Tim Sherwood has tipped Manchester City to win the Premier League title this season.

Spurs fell to a 4-0 defeat at the hands of Liverpool this afternoon, a result that saw the Reds climb to the top of the table for the first time since Christmas.

Sherwood praised the improvement of the Merseyside outfit this season and admitted that they stood a chance of ending their 24-year wait for a league title, but he still believes that City hold the edge over them and Chelsea.

"I would still go with Manchester City. Liverpool have done a fantastic job, from last season to this is chalk and cheese. They are still in this race," Sherwood told reporters.

"The players they have in the final third are sensational. They run and graft. If they tighten up a bit I think they have a good chance."

Today's defeat leaves Spurs four points behind fifth-placed Everton having played a game more than the Toffees.
